PowerColor Intros Custom-Design Radeon HD 6900 Video Cards
By Cássio Lima on December 27, 2010 - 3:18 PM


PowerColor has unveiled Radeon HD 6900 video cards equipped with a custom cooling solution that according to the manufacturer is more efficient and quieter than the stock cooler. The new cooler features two 92-mm fans and 8-mm cooper heatpipes.

In terms of clocks, the new Radeon HD 6900 video cards from PowerColor have the stock clocks (Radeon HD 6950: 800 MHz/5 GHz for GPU and memory, respectively; Radeon HD 6970: 880 MHz/5.5 GHz for GPU and memory, respectively). Both cards have 2 GB of GDDR5 memory and feature DVI, HDMI and mini-DisplayPort connectors. No word on pricing was provided.
